Register Now: Third BEB Familiarization Distance Learning Session on Battery Charging Alternatives

Posted March 2021


The Transportation Learning Center is pleased to announce the third installment of an online course on Battery Electric Bus (BEB) familiarization. This session will address various alternatives to battery charging and is intended for bus and facility technicians, instructors, and those interested in learning more about the technical and maintenance aspects of this rapidly emerging technology.

When: Tuesday, March 23, 1:00 pm - 3:00 pm ET

The free  two-hour course will be live during which you can ask questions. You can access the course on your computer, smart phone or tablet. The event will be recorded and made available on the Center’s website at a later date.

The previous two sessions were well-received and attracted over 400 attendees. You can view Sessions 1 and 2 and download accompanying materials from the Center’s website:  https://www.transittraining.net/courseware/details/battery-electric-bus-familiarization .

Presenters:

  Randy Premo, BYD: Charging Overview
  David Warren, New Flyer: Charging Considerations & Technology
  James Hall, Proterra: Charger Standards, Maintenance & Safety
  Amy Posner, CTE: Charger Selection, Fleet Size Considerations & Managed Charging
      Options
